What happens when you spray a cat with vinegar?

While the cats do not like vinegar and likely will not want to taste it, keep undiluted vinegar secured and out of their reach, since it is acidic and can cause vomiting, diarrhea, oral irritation, and pain , according to ASPCA.

What happens if a cat eats baking soda?

If a cat does eat too much, it can result in an electrolyte imbalance due to decreased potassium and calcium and increased sodium levels Symptoms of baking soda toxicity include diarrhea, vomiting, shortness of breath, disorientation, seizures and tremors, increased thirst, and signs of dehydration.

Do cats hate garlic?

Garlic contains compounds called disulfides and thiosulphates, which can cause the red blood cells circulating through a cat’s body to become very fragile and burst. Therefore, ingesting garlic may result in the destruction of a cat’s red blood cells, a deadly condition known as hemolytic anemia.

Will cayenne pepper hurt cats?

Cayenne pepper is not toxic to cats in itself That said, if a cat digs or walks in an area with cayenne pepper sprinkled over it, the pepper may get stuck to the paws and fur. If they clean themselves, the pepper could get into their eyes and cause pain and irritation.
